ATS tips for Cleaners of Vehicles and Equipment applications
- Save and submit as PDF unless British Airways explicitly asks for DOCX — both stay machine-readable, but follow the posting.
- Use a single-column layout; multi-column and text-in-images break most ATS parsers for Cleaners of Vehicles and Equipment applications.
- Spell out acronyms once (e.g. the full term then the abbreviation) so keyword matching for Cleaners of Vehicles and Equipment catches both forms.
- Use standard section headings — "Experience", "Skills", "Education" — so the parser maps your Cleaners of Vehicles and Equipment resume correctly.
